Output ef39e31433de76bc26fec10fdaf7db11d5cc2ba9ecf249e1878775e16a6d6d9b:1

value
193053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80bf3addd971bff09352c0804368814041d3ce1e OP_EQUAL
address
3DRmVzF2cdGaENsELA7FVCgev8Yum8krU8
transaction
ef39e31433de76bc26fec10fdaf7db11d5cc2ba9ecf249e1878775e16a6d6d9b
spent
true